At 02:45 AM 10/20/98 -0500, Sean Donelan wrote:
LessonsLearned: Did you know standby generator makers have a universal key for the maintenance hatches on your generator sitting outside your building. All 'authorized' service people all over the country have it. How many folks knew there was a black market for generator starting batteries? How many folks have ever gone outside to their generator and found the battery gone? When was the last time you checked? How many folks have tamper switches on their generator panels? How many folks just picked up the phone to have their facilities people install some?
